A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

During the cleaning process of existing building material detection devices, concrete is easily attached to the cleaning strip, resulting in poor cleaning effect, affecting cleaning continuity and efficiency, and increasing maintenance difficulty and cost.

Method used

The linear vibration motor in the cleaning box drives the bearing platform to vibrate. Combined with the guide groove and sewage pipe, the concrete is quickly dropped by gravity, and the water pump and spray assembly are used for flushing and cleaning to prevent the concrete from drying and solidifying.

Benefits of technology

The cleaning efficiency and practicality of the slump cone are improved, the convenience of next use is ensured, the concrete is prevented from drying and solidifying in the cone, and the maintenance difficulty and cost are reduced.

Technical Field

[0001] The utility model belongs to the technical field of building material detection, and particularly relates to a convenient device for building material detection. Background Art

[0002] Building material testing is an important part of ensuring building quality and safety. Before pouring concrete, staff are required to test the quality of the concrete. At the same time, a slump cone will be used to test the quality of the concrete.

[0003] The utility model of Chinese patent publication number CN221351486U discloses a convenient device for testing building materials, including a slump cone. The interior of the slump cone is provided with a cleaning component for automatically cleaning the slump cone after the concrete slump test is completed. One side of the cleaning component is provided with a driving component for driving the cleaning component to automatically clean the concrete on the inner wall of the slump cone; by arranging the cleaning component, the driving component and the protection component, the slump cone is placed in the protection component after the test is completed, and inserted into the cleaning component, and the driving component is turned on to rotate the cleaning component, thereby cleaning the inner wall of the slump cone. This arrangement does not require the staff to manually clean the inner wall after the slump cone test is completed, and the time saved can be used for other work. The automatic cleaning of the slump cone makes it convenient to use.

[0004] The existing patent uses a cleaning strip to scrape the concrete in the collapse cylinder. However, due to the high viscosity of the concrete, it is easy to adhere to the cleaning strip. If it is not cleaned in time, the cleaning effect will be reduced, and the concrete will dry and solidify, damaging the cleaning strip. As a result, the staff cannot use it a second time, affecting the continuity and efficiency of cleaning, and increasing costs and maintenance difficulties. Utility Model Content

[0034] The working principle and use process of the utility model: During use, the staff first places the used slump cone on the top of the guide groove 35 on the top of the supporting platform 33, and rotates the slump cone so that the foot pedal on the side of the slump cone is stuck in the fixed groove 36;

[0035] Then, the linear vibration motor 37 is started. The vibration of the linear vibration motor 37 drives the supporting platform 33 to vibrate up and down, so that the concrete remaining in the slump cone falls due to the action of gravity, and is guided by the guide groove 35, and then flows into the sewage pipe 31 through the sewage outlet 32, and then flows out. The high-frequency vibration can make the concrete attached to the inside of the slump cone fall quickly, thereby effectively improving the cleanliness of the inside of the slump cone and preventing the concrete remaining in the slump cone from drying and solidifying inside the slump cone to avoid affecting the next use, thereby effectively improving the practicality and convenience of the slump cone and facilitating the use of the staff.

[0036] While performing vibration cleaning, the staff can also insert one end of the input pipe 41 into the water source and start the water pump 4 to allow the water pump 4 to extract water. Then, through the circulation of the output pipe 42 and the water spray pipe 43, water can be sprayed out through the nozzle 44, thereby flushing and cleaning the inside of the slump cone, which not only effectively improves the cleaning efficiency of the slump cone, but also avoids damage to the inside of the slump cone.
